Sunshine is also very important to facultative lagoons because it contributes to the growth of green algae on the water surface area. Because algae are plants, they need sunshine for photosynthesis. Oxygen is a byproduct of photosynthesis, and the existence of green algae contributes significantly to the amount of oxygen in the aerobic zone.

The oxygen in the aerobic zone makes conditions favorable for aerobic bacteria. Both aerobic and anaerobic bacteria are extremely important to the wastewater treatment process and to each other. Bacteria treat wastewater by converting it into other compounds. Aerobic germs convert wastes into carbon dioxide, ammonia, and phosphates, which, in turn, are used by the algae as food.

In addition, the sludge layer at the bottom of the lagoon has lots of anaerobic germs, sludge worms, and other organisms, which offer treatment through digestion and avoid the sludge from rapidly accumulating to the point where it requires to be gotten rid of.

Sludge in all lagoons accumulates more quickly in cold than in warm temperatures. However, many facultative lagoons are developed to function well without sludge removal for 5 to 10 years or more. Lagoons should be developed by certified experts who have actually had experience with them. License requirements and guidelines worrying elements of lagoon style differ, but there are some style problems common to all lagoons.

Lagoons likewise need to lie downgrade and downwind from the houses they serve, when possible, to avoid the additional expense of pumping the wastewater uphill and to prevent odors from becoming a nuisance.

Any obstructions to wind or sunlight, such as trees or surrounding hillsides need to be considered. Trees and weed growth around lagoons should be managed for the exact same reasons. In addition, water from surface drainage or storm overflow need to be stayed out of lagoons, if necessary install diversion terraces or drains pipes above the website.

The size and shape of lagoons is designed to take full advantage of the quantity of time the wastewater remains in the lagoon. Detention time is normally the most important consider treatment. In general, facultative lagoons need about one acre for every single 50 homes or every 200 people they serve. Aerated lagoons treat wastewater more effectively, so they tend to require anywhere from one-third to one-tenth less land than facultative lagoons.

Lagoons can be round, square, or rectangle-shaped with rounded corners. Their length ought to not exceed 3 times their width, and their banks must have outside slopes of about three units horizontal to one unit vertical. This moderate slope makes the banks much easier to cut and preserve. In systems that have dikes separating lagoon cells, dikes also need to be easy to preserve.

The bottoms of lagoons should be as flat and level as possible (except around the inlet) to help with the continuous circulation of the wastewater. Keeping the corners of lagoons rounded likewise helps to keep the general hydraulic pattern in the lagoons and prevents dead areas in the flow, called short-circuiting, which can impact treatment.

Partial-mix aerated lagoons are often designed to be deeper than facultative lagoons to permit room for sludge to pick the bottom and rest undisturbed by the turbulent conditions developed by the aeration procedure. Wastewater enters and leaves the lagoon through inlet and outlet pipelines. Modern creates place the inlet as far as possible from the outlet, on opposite ends of the lagoons, to increase detention times and to avoid short-circuiting.

Outlets are created depending on the technique of discharge. They often consist of structures that permit the water level to be raised and decreased. Aerators, which are used instead of algae as the primary source of oxygen in aerated lagoons, work by launching air into the lagoon or by upseting the water so that air from the surface is blended in (how to dredge a farm pond).

Different aerator designs produce either great or coarse bubbles, and work either on the water surface area or submerged. Subsurface aerators are more suitable in climates where the lagoon is most likely to be covered by ice for part of the year. One of the benefits of lagoons is that they need fewer personnel hours to run and maintain than many other systems.

Routine inspections, testing, record keeping, and upkeep are needed by regional and state companies, and are all essential to make sure that lagoons continue to supply excellent treatment. How frequently lagoons need to be checked depends upon the type of lagoon, how well it works, and local and state requirements. Some lagoons require more frequent monitoring in the spring and summertime, when lawn and weeds grow rapidly and when seasonal rental residential or commercial properties are inhabited.

Amongst the most important indicators are biochemical oxygen demand (BODY) and overall suspended solids (TSS). Body is necessary because it measures just how much oxygen organisms in the wastewater would take in when released to getting waters. TSS measures the amount of solid materials in the wastewater. If BOD or TSS levels in the effluent are too high, they can degrade the quality of getting waters (lake sediment removal).

Lastly, the depth of the sludge layer in lagoons need to be inspected at least once per year, generally from a boat utilizing a long stick or hollow tube. In most lagoon systems, sludge ultimately accumulates to a point it must be removed, although this may take years. Performance will suffer if excessive sludge is allowed to accumulate.
